Part 2: The Job

“This place smells funny,” complained Muhammad in Persian.
Khafeh,” Shaheeda warned, whacking him on the head. “You’re lucky no one here speaks Farsi.”
The other passengers looked at them, confused as to what tongue they were speaking. After all, Muhammad was evidently Afghan while Shaheeda was “blasian”. However, they went about their business.
“What will we do when we get to Port Said?” Muhammad asked.
“Catch a boat to Anatolia, of course,” she replied.
“What if we get caught?” he inquired.
“We won’t,” she assured him. “Besides,” she said smiling. “If we get caught, you’ll never get to marry Hatice.”
“Don’t remind me of that,” he said. “That girl is so annoying! Ugh!”
“If you don’t marry her, who will you marry? No one else would take you, mate.”
“If no one else takes me, I’ll just marry you!” he said, putting her in a headlock.
Shaheeda promptly stomped on his foot.
“OW!” he yelped.
Shaheeda smiled again. “Just go to sleep,” she told him. “We’re a long way from our destination.”


“Sir, a guard was reported dead outside the palace,” said the guard.
“Dead?” Asim questioned. “Who would dare kill one of our guards?”
“We don’t know sir. And no one saw who did it.”
He thought a moment. “Perhaps a disgruntled citizen, who opposes our rule. When you find out who it is, tell me. Perhaps they’ll lead us to more traitors.”
“Yes sir!” he said.


Mehmet Pasha paid the cloaked man in front of him.
“You’ll get it done, right?” he asked.
“Sure, easy peasy,” came the reply.
Mehmet nodded. He had been in contact with Nic Furia for a while now, a mole in Asim’s ranks. Now, he was engaging in sabotage. While this wouldn’t be big, it certainly would scare Asim. But if the man was caught, he might point the finger at Mehmet, and that was dangerous. Every day, he prayed he wouldn’t see soldiers at his door, ready to arrest him for treason. It was dangerous, but Mehmet was dedicated.
Dedicated to saving his country.
